The portfolio is heavily concentrated in three ETFs: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(40.3%), Vanguard Information Technology Index Fund ETF Shares (30.7%), and Invesco NASDAQ 100 ETF (29%). This composition shows a strong tilt towards large-cap U.S. stocks, particularly in the technology sector. While these ETFs are well-regarded, the lack of diversification could expose the portfolio to significant sector-specific risks. To mitigate this, consider diversifying into other sectors and asset classes to spread risk more evenly across the portfolio.

Historically, the portfolio has performed well, boasting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.43%. However, it also experienced a maximum drawdown of -30.71%, indicating substantial volatility. This high performance comes with high risk, which is typical for a growth-oriented portfolio. To better manage risk, it might be wise to include some less volatile investments. This could help stabilize returns during market downturns.

Using a Monte Carlo simulation with 1,000 iterations, the portfolio shows a wide range of potential outcomes. The 5th percentile projects a 59.35% return, while the 50th percentile projects 499.53%, and the 67th percentile projects 803.41%. This indicates a high level of uncertainty but also significant upside potential. Such simulations highlight the importance of maintaining a long-term investment horizon to ride out periods of volatility and capitalize on potential gains.

The sector allocation is heavily skewed towards technology (57.1%), followed by smaller allocations in Communication Services (8.3%) and Consumer Cyclicals (8%). This concentration in a single sector increases vulnerability to sector-specific downturns. Diversifying into other sectors like Healthcare, Financial Services, and Industrials can help balance the portfolio. This would reduce dependence on the technology sector and provide more stable returns.

Geographically, the portfolio is overwhelmingly focused on North America (98.7%), with minimal exposure to other regions. This lack of international diversification can be a risk if the U.S. market underperforms. Including investments from Europe, Asia, and other regions could provide a hedge against regional downturns and tap into growth opportunities in other parts of the world. This would make the portfolio more resilient to geographic-specific risks.

The total expense ratio (TER) of the portfolio is 0.09%, which is quite low. The individual costs are 0.15% for Invesco NASDAQ 100 ETF, 0.1% for Vanguard Information Technology Index Fund ETF Shares, and 0.03% for Vanguard S&P 500 ETF. Low costs are a significant advantage, as they allow more of the investment returns to be retained. Keeping investment costs low is a key principle for long-term portfolio growth. This cost efficiency should be maintained while considering diversification.
